PEGylated Cisplatin Nanoparticles for Treating Colorectal Cancer in a pH-Responsive Manner

Figure 5

The P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ling pathway. (a) Protein expression of PI3K, phosphorylated PI3K, AKT, phosphorylated AKT, mTOR, phosphorylated mTOR, and β-actin by western blot in CT26 cells treated with PBS, cisplatin, HA-Cis, and HA-mPEG-Cis NPs (cisplatin equivalent of 3 μg/mL). (b) Relative protein expression of PI3K and p-PI3K. (c) Relative protein expression of AKT and p-AKT. (d) Relative protein expression of mTOR and p-mTOR. .
